Common Construction Accidents That May Qualify for Funding
Construction sites involve heavy machinery, elevated work areas, and multiple contractors, making accidents common. Some of the most frequent types of incidents we provide pre-settlement funding for include:
- Falls from height: Injuries from scaffolding, ladders, or roofs, often resulting in fractures or spinal trauma.
- Equipment accidents: Injuries caused by cranes, forklifts, or other heavy machinery.
- Trench collapses: Crushed injuries or suffocation from unstable excavation sites.
- Electrocutions: Injuries from live wires or malfunctioning electrical equipment.
- Struck-by or caught–in accidents: Being hit by falling objects or trapped in machinery.
These accidents often involve multiple liable parties, including employers, contractors, or equipment manufacturers. Pre-settlement funding can help you withstand delays in settlements caused by disputes over liability.
How Long You Have to File a Construction Accident Claim in Arizona
If you’ve been injured on a construction site in Arizona, it’s important to understand the time limits for filing a personal injury claim. These deadlines are set by state law and are known as statutes of limitations. Missing these deadlines can prevent you from pursuing compensation for medical bills, lost wages, and pain and suffering.
In Arizona, the statute of limitations for most personal injury claims, including construction accidents, is two years from the date of the accident. This means you generally have 24 months to file a lawsuit against the responsible parties. However, there can be exceptions depending on the circumstances of your case.
Acting promptly is important not only to preserve your legal rights but also to ensure evidence is collected. Witnesses’ memories fade, documents can be lost, and physical evidence may no longer be available if you wait too long.

How Pre-Settlement Funding Works in Arizona
The Arizona construction accident pre-settlement funding process is straightforward. Here’s what you need to do:
- Submit an application: Provide basic information about your case online or by phone.
- Case review: Our team assesses your claim, reviewing documentation provided by you and your attorney.
- Approval and funding: Decisions are typically made within 24 to 48 hours, and funds are sent shortly after approval.
- Repayment only if you win: You owe nothing if your case is unsuccessful, making the funding completely risk-free.
This non-recourse funding model ensures that financial stress doesn’t compromise your recovery or your attorney’s ability to negotiate a fair settlement.
